Journal Techno Entrepreneur Acta merupakan jurnal ilmiah yang berfokus pada pengembangan keilmuan di bidang keteknikan dan sains yang terintegrasi dengan nilai-nilai kewirausahaan (techno-entrepreneurship). Jurnal ini bertujuan untuk menjadi media publikasi yang kredibel dalam mendiseminasikan hasil penelitian dan kajian ilmiah yang berkontribusi terhadap pengembangan teknologi terapan, inovasi, serta peningkatan kualitas sumber daya manusia yang adaptif dan berdaya saing. Jurnal ini mempublikasikan artikel hasil penelitian asli (original research articles) dan artikel tinjauan (review articles) yang telah melalui proses peer review secara objektif dan sistematis. Cakupan bidang meliputi, namun tidak terbatas pada, Teknik Mesin, Arsitektur, Teknik Sipil, Teknik Elektro, serta Teknik Kimia/Kimia Sains, termasuk kajian interdisipliner yang mengaitkan teknologi dengan kewirausahaan dan pengembangan masyarakat. Sebagai jurnal berbasis akses terbuka (open access), seluruh konten yang diterbitkan dapat diakses secara bebas oleh pembaca untuk mendukung penyebaran ilmu pengetahuan secara luas. Journal Techno Entrepreneur Acta berkomitmen untuk menjaga standar etika publikasi ilmiah, kualitas editorial, serta integritas dalam setiap proses penerbitan. Jurnal ini diterbitkan secara berkala sesuai dengan kebijakan yang ditetapkan dan dikelola menggunakan sistem Open Journal Systems (OJS) untuk memastikan transparansi, efisiensi, dan akuntabilitas dalam proses pengelolaan dan publikasi artikel ilmiah.

The useful life of reinforced concrete structural elements could mean that the structural elements of reinforced concrete is not able to withstand the repeated load. In this regard, conducted research that aims to understand the behavior of reinforced concrete flexural loading fatigue and effects receives tired and reinforcements Sheet Glass Fiber Reinforced Polymer (GFRP-S). Methods to set boundaries or controls in the calculation of the capacity of the test beam and its impact on behavior and reinforcement in the beam test obtained in a number of references. This study makes a test beam with a full-scale model with a size of 300 x 500 x 6000 mm. Number of test blocks are provided each with 4 pieces of reinforced concrete. Tests conducted on the technique of static loading on 3 pieces of test beams A 1, B 1 and B 2 and the fatigue loading on the first specimens of B 2 with 1:25 Hz cycle frequency. The results showed that the effect of fatigue on concrete receiving sufficient load capacity and a big influence on the behavior of concrete. Concrete receiving static load is able to accept a maximum load of 470 kN while the concrete receiving the fatigue load is able to accept the fatigue load minimum 75 kN and 260 kN maximum endures to 1,300,000 cycles with a greater deflection behavior. Observations on the beam construction of static and fatigue loading test showed retrofitting of GFRP-S is able to increase the capacity of the test beam in the receiving load. Capacity test on the beam reinforcement GFRP has not mencapai ultimate theoretical capacity, so it needs further study regarding pengaruh cracking and melting before retrofitting GFRP rebars. Analysis of fatigue in structures is essential for the achievement of the design life of the structure and the salvation of mankind

In the management of parking during this run visible indicators that can be used as a benchmark as the low contribution of parking service on revenue of Makassar and still less professional and optimal management of parking. This study aims to determine the level of optimization of the application of the parking management system by operators of parking based on public perception and analyze the level of service and high availability of parking facilities in the city of Makassar. This research was conducted by direct interview to the community and the spread of random questionnaires to determine public perceptions of parking management that are run during this and subsequent analysis of the level of service and availability of parking infrastructure by taking samples of the two locations in the city of Makassar. From the results of research in getting that parking geometric arrangement resulted in the design markings on the road Bougainville Makassar park consists of 26 markers and 20 markers of motor cars, while road markings Pengayoman consists of 146 cars and 54 motorcycles markers. Overall capacity of the car park on the street Bougainville 104 vehicles/h, the capacity of the car park on the street Pengayoman the west as much as 584 vehicles/hour. Capacity motorcycle parking on the street Bougainville as many as 80 vehicles/hour, capacity bike parking on the street Pengayoman the west as much as 216 vehicles / hour. For availability of parking facilities in addition to marking problems of parking, availability of infrastructure such as parking signs, SRP and parking attendants in Bougainville and western aegis not ideal should be added and equipped. Potential revenue (PAD), which can be generated at the study site from the calculation of the accumulation of cars and motorcycles parked vehicles every 15 minutes in the span of 13 hours every day for a week total daily average of Rp. 1,657,346. The respondent's perception of the overall entry in the medium category. For the highest score obtained at a frequency of parking of vehicles in the parking lot was not authorized by a score of 1054. While the lowest score in the delivery of tickets, with a score of 716. Overall it can be concluded that the availability of parking infrastructures is lacking and parking management systems are still considered less than optimal.

PT. Usaha Timur Gowa merupakan perusahaan Industri yang bergerak dalam industri Sari Buah Markisa. Pada proses produksi mesin utama yang digunakan adalah alat press atau sentrifugal. Dalam penelitian ini akan dilakukan perancangan jadwal perawatan mesin. Untuk menjamin kelancaran suatu proses produksi maka diperlukan adanya sistem perawatan yang teratur agar mesin dapat berjalan dengan baik. Karena apabila sering terjadi breakdown pada jam operasi maka akan menghambat proses produksi. Sistem perawatan yang baik dapat meningkatkan keandalan suatu mesin. Selanjutnya dilakukan pengolahan data dengan bantuan Software Weibull++4.3 sebagai penentu analisis data yang terkait dengan hasil penanganan mesin selama periode satu tahun dengan total rata-rata waktu 8 jam per satu kali beroperasi, dari data waktu antar kerusakan. untuk mengetahui distribusi data yang digunakan guna menentukan ekspektasi nilai kerusakan komponen mesin dengan metode MTTF (Mean Time To Failure). MTTF merupakan interval waktu maksimal dalam menggunakan komponen mesin sampai komponen mesin tersebut rusak. Komponen impeller pada mesin ekstracktor sentrifugal mempunyai ekspektasi kerusakan pada jam ke-247 yang dianggap akan mampu membawa dampak yang lebih baik dengan referensi jadwal interval perawatan pada Shaft, Casing, Impeller, Bearing, Coupling dan packing and seal merupakan factor penyebab kerusakan mesin pada PT. Usaha Timor Gowa , hal ini agar dapat dilakukan pada manajemen produksi khususnya pada penanganan mesin ekstracktor sentrifugal yakni mesin pemisah biji markisa untuk menghindari breakdown. Strategi perawatan dalam bentuk pemeliharaan selang optimal disusun untuk mencapai target dengan tingkat keandalan system dan interval perawatan dapat di tentukan untuk mencegah insiden kerusakan selanjutnya antara 247.2712 jam (10 hari) dan 558.9799jam (32 hari)

Batubara merupakan bahan bakar fosil yang dapat dijadikan sebagai sumber bahan bakar alternatif pengganti bahan bakar minyak bumi dan gas alam yang sudah semakin menipis. Cadangan batubara di Indonesia, khususnya di Sulawesi cukup berpotensi, namun hingga saat ini belum dapat dimanfaatkan sebagai bahan bakar mengingat kandungan sulfurnya relatif tinggi yang dapat menyebabkan kerusakan pada alat pembakaran, dan dapat menimbulkan pencemaran lingkungan, kecuali terlebih dahulu dilakukan proses desulfurisasi sebelum pembakaran (precombustion). Penelitian ini bertujuan untuk mereduksi kandungan sulfur pirit dalam batubara sehingga memenuhi kriteria untuk dimanfaatkan sebagai salah satu bahan bakar industry. Secara khusus penelitian ini bertujuan untuk mempelajari mekanisme dan kinetika depiritsasi batubara menggunakan oksidator feri sulfat, sebagai usaha meminimalisasi kandungan sulfur batubara tersebut, maka dilakukan penelitian Desulfurisasi Batubara Menggunakan Oksidator Besi (III) Hasil Olahan Limbah Besi. Penelitian desulfurisasi batubara asal Mallawa (Sulawesi) skala laboratorium dilakukan dalam sebuah reaktor (labu leher empat) dengan sistem semi batch, dilengkapi dengan sebuah kompressor, flowmeter, termometer dan pengaduk. Karakterisasi, analisis proximate dan ultimate batubara dilakukan mengikuti prosedur ASTM Standar. Analisis sulfur total dilakukan dengan metode esckha yang dikombinasi dengan spektrofotometer UV, sedangkan nilai kalor batubara diukur dengan alat bomb kalorimeter. Dari hasil per hitungan diperoleh nilai orde reaksi n = 1,771. Nilai ini ternyata tidak bulat tetapi pecahan yang menunjukkan bahwa reaksi depiritisasi dengan pereaksi besi (III) sulfat merupakan reaksi kompleks yang terdiri dari beberapa tahap reaksi. Hasil penelitian ini diperoleh persamaan kinetika depiritisasi batubara dengan pereaksi besi (III) sulfat pada suhu 90 oC, kecepatan pengadukan 930 rpm sebagai berikut : – rS = 6,741.10-2.CS(1,771)
